What affects the price

When you start planning a fireplace installation, the final bill depends on a few major factors. Choosing between a simple electric unit, a gas insert, or a full wood-burning masonry build creates the biggest difference in cost. You also have to consider the existing setup of your home; running new gas lines or venting through a roof will naturally add labor hours compared to a straightforward swap. Finishing materials like custom stonework or mantel pieces also shift the total.
